Output 18594d9defbc2c83fe8f503f825ad285ace881f63fe0731e58bab2163feed5fe:1

value
2506038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 502c2faea9a77fd3494c27b6700c58c2c9a96ff6 OP_EQUALVERIFY OP_CHECKSIG
address
18JuzTmZtT6yeFVjfQQ3xGPjyPLkgJZSan
transaction
18594d9defbc2c83fe8f503f825ad285ace881f63fe0731e58bab2163feed5fe
spent
true